Transaction 3f70429459a7bf4eac688a1de3f36b4ba50c16d2632b72241a9b6c43371e0d85

2 Input
2 Outputs
  • 3f70429459a7bf4eac688a1de3f36b4ba50c16d2632b72241a9b6c43371e0d85:0
  • value  11758
    address  13WUrhKyUUTrwBTaoiUDGg5GwBhEJyd8Kx
  • 3f70429459a7bf4eac688a1de3f36b4ba50c16d2632b72241a9b6c43371e0d85:1
  • value  1518300
    address  1NZqk9TYgaCeCfeshHdKTkhkCU9EiSDAKx